The final stage in iron ore processing is ironmaking, where the iron ore is transformed into molten iron through a process called reduction. The most common method of ironmaking is the blast furnace route. In a blast furnace, iron ore, coke (carbon), and fluxes (limestone or dolomite) are loaded into the furnace from the top.

The results show that the EU27 has the third highest production costs for hot rolled coil via the integrated route (458 EUR/t). The main contributors to these costs are the raw material costs 65%, the 'other costs' 27% and energy costs 17%. The CO 2 cost is included in 'other costs' and for the EU27 represents 2% of the total production ...

Australia is the world's largest iron ore exporter (and 2nd largest producer) accounting for around a third of global production. Western Australia holds just over 90% of Australia's identified iron ore resources and has a reputation for producing consistently high concentrations of around 60%.

The ITmk3 process uses low-grade iron ore and coal (other feedstocks can be used as supplements) to produce iron nuggets whose quality is superior to that of DRI (97% iron content) but is similar to that of pig iron. The mixing, agglomeration, and feeding steps are the same as in the production of DRI or BFs, but the RHF is operated differently.
